What is a consultant?
Consultants primarily act as business advisors
to clients.
– Identify new opportunities.
– Accelerate the competitive performance of clients.
– Align processes to technology.
– Deliver compelling solutions to vexing issues.
Consultants provide real business benefits to
clients.
– Help them make faster, smarter decisions.
– Reduce their business risks.
– Capitalize on their core competencies.
– Increase their Return on Investment (ROI).

Consultants really have a challenging set of responsibilities.
Serve as effective business advisors, change agents, facilitators and/or leaders
who are responsive to the client's needs.
Conduct research, data collection and analysis and synthesis to prepare, present
and deliver recommendations and solutions to clients.
Use a range of methodologies, assets and work products to produce deliverables.
Create and use intellectual capital to solve diverse, business issues in innovative
ways.
Understand technology in order to offer clients recommendations and solutions
that meet their business and IT needs as appropriate.
Participate in the delivery and implementation of solutions for clients.
